Use rigid or semi -rigid board for <br />duct insulations. <br />Foil- scrim - polyethylene vapor barrier jacket, factory applied to insulation, maximum permeance of .02 <br />perms. <br />PVC FITTING COVERS AND JACKETS: <br />White PVC film, gloss finish one side, semi -gloss other side, FS LP -535D, Composition A, Type II, <br />Grade GU. Ultraviolet inhibited indoor /outdoor grade to be used where exposed to high humidity, <br />ultraviolet radiation, in kitchens or food processing areas or installed outdoors. Jacket thickness to be <br />minimum .02" indoors /.03 "outdoors for piping 12" and smaller, .03" indoors /.04" outdoors for piping <br />15" and larger. <br />METAL JACKETS: <br />.016 inch thick aluminum or .010 inch thick stainless steel with safety edge. <br />SELF - ADHERING JACKETS: <br />Self- adhering waterproofing membrane consisting of laminated reflective high density aluminum foil, <br />high density waterproof polymer films and 40 mil rubberized adhesive asphalt waterproofing <br />compound with release paper. <br />INSULATION INSERTS AND PIPE SHIELDS: <br />Manufacturers: B -Line, Pipe Shields, Value Engineered Products <br />Construct inserts with calcium silicate or polyisocyanu rate (service temperatures below 300 degrees <br />F only), minimum 140 psi compressive strength. Piping 12" and larger, supplement with high density <br />600 psi structural calcium silicate insert. Provide galvanized steel shield. Insert and shield to be <br />minimum 180 degree coverage on bottom supported piping and full 360 degree coverage on <br />clamped piping. On roller mounted piping and piping designed to slide on support, provide additional <br />load distribution steel plate. <br />Where contractor proposes shop /site fabricated inserts and shields, submit schedule of materials, <br />thicknesses, gauges and lengths for each pipe size to demonstrate equivalency to <br />preengi neered/preman ufactu red product described above.
